Doors and Windows in the UK: A Comprehensive Guide
In the UK, the significance of windows and doors extends far beyond mere looks. They play an essential function in energy effectiveness, security, and convenience in homes. With a large variety of designs, materials, and innovations offered, property owners must make informed choices to ensure their selections fulfill their needs and choices. This post explores the kinds of windows and doors frequently discovered in the UK, recent trends, energy efficiency standards, and installation considerations.

Windows are important for ventilation, natural lighting, and energy efficiency. Below prevail kinds of windows used in the UK:
Type of WindowDescriptionCasement WindowsHinged at the side, casement windows open outward and are popular for providing exceptional ventilation.Sash WindowsCommonly found in older structures, sash windows include 2 sliding panels and can be single or double hung.Tilt and TurnThese versatile windows can be slanted inwards for ventilation or turned totally for cleaning, making them user-friendly.Bay and Bow WindowsThese extending windows develop a feeling of space, permitting more light into the space and typically using a panoramic view.Fixed WindowsFixed and non-opening, these windows make the most of views and natural light without jeopardizing energy efficiency.SkylightsInstalled on the roof, skylights bring in abundant light and can assist in lowering energy expenses when effectively positioned.Key Features to ConsiderEnergy Efficiency: Look for double or triple glazing to improve insulation and lower energy costs.Frame Materials: Options include wood, vinyl, aluminum, and fiberglass, each with its pros and cons concerning visual appeals and longevity.Security: Locking mechanisms and laminated glass improve the safety of windows.Style Style: The window style should complement the general architecture of the home.Current Trends in Doors and Windows

With sustainability ending up being a concern, energy performance in doors and windows is vital. The UK complies with rigorous structure policies intended at decreasing carbon footprints:
U-Values: Indicates how much heat is lost through a window or door-- the lower the U-value, the much better the insulation.Energy Ratings: Windows and doors are typically rated on a scale from A++ to E, showing their energy performance.Glazing Options: Double or triple-glazing windows avoid heat loss and improve energy performance.Installation Considerations

1. What is the finest material for external doors?
The very best material depends upon private requirements. Wood is traditional and aesthetically pleasing, while composite and uPVC offer high sturdiness and low upkeep.
2. How can I enhance the energy effectiveness of my windows?
Updating to double glazing, using thermal drapes, or using window movies can significantly enhance insulation.
3. What should I try to find in security features for doors?
Try to find sturdy products, multi-point locking mechanisms, and enhanced frames.
4. Are bi-fold doors appropriate for little spaces?
Yes, bi-fold doors can open up and create a simple transition between indoors and outdoors without taking up much area when open.
5. How frequently should I change my windows?
Windows typically last around 15-20 years, but indications of wear, bad insulation, and condensation can show the need for replacement earlier.
